Classic Space Warfare at Its Finest
Freespace 2 delivers an exhilarating blend of intense dogfighting and strategic mission design, solidifying its reputation as one of the greatest space combat simulators available for Windows. Set in the far future of 2367, players take the helm of a space fighter pilot drawn into a desperate interstellar conflict between humanity and a powerful, mysterious alien force known as the Shivans.
Deep, Atmospheric Storytelling
The narrative unfolds through cinematic briefings, in-mission dialogue, and memorable voice acting, immersing players in high-stakes operations within a crumbling galactic alliance. The game's branching plot ensures that choices resonate throughout the campaign, while radio chatter and dramatic set pieces create a vivid sense of urgency and scale.
Responsive Controls and Combat Precision
Freespace 2 is celebrated for its precise flight controls and intuitive HUD. Players can issue wingman commands, manage power distribution across shields, engines, and weapons, and utilize an arsenal of customizable ships and equipment. Engaging in massive fleet battles, evading enemy fire, and coordinating strikes highlight the depth of the combat system.
Stunning Visuals and Epic Soundtrack
Despite its late 1990s release, the game’s graphics engine impresses with sprawling nebulae, colossal capital ships, and dazzling weapon effects. The soundtrack heightens every encounter, from tense stealth insertions to full-scale planetary assaults.
Modding Community and Longevity
Freespace 2’s enduring appeal stems in part from a vibrant fan community. Open-source releases have led to visual upgrades and total conversion mods, ensuring ongoing content and compatibility with modern systems.
Revisit a Timeless Space Experience
While newer titles have built on the foundation laid by Freespace 2, few match its satisfying blend of narrative depth, mission variety, and pure space combat excitement. Both newcomers and veterans will find much to enjoy in this acclaimed classic.
